About Messiah

Messiah University is a nationally ranked, private Christian university with a student body of 3,454 undergraduate and graduate students. The scenic 385-acre suburban campus was founded in 1909 by the Brethren in Christ Church and is located just 12 miles from the state capital of Harrisburg. Today, the University’s faith base is broadly evangelical and includes students and employees from a variety of denominations and Christian faith traditions.

Statements of Faith

Messiah University affirms the historic Apostle's Creed as its central statement of faith. In addition, Messiah asks that all community members support the Confession of Faith which expresses the faith orientation of the University in a nonsectarian manner that highlights the specific emphases of the Anabaptist, Pietist and Wesleyan traditions of the Christian faith. It is included frequently in campus worship.
